+# HEADER_CHECK(header [NAME variable] [INCLUDE_FILES extra1.h .. extraN.h])
+#
+# Check if the header file exists, in such case define variable
+# in configuration file.
+#
+# Variable defaults to HAVE_${HEADER}, where HEADER is the uppercase
+# representation of the first parameter. It can be overridden using
+# NAME keyword.
+#
+# To include extra files, then use INCLUDE_FILES keyword.
+function(HEADER_CHECK header)
+ string(TOUPPER HAVE_${header} var)
+ string(REGEX REPLACE "[^a-zA-Z0-9]" "_" var "${var}")
+ string(REGEX REPLACE "_{2,}" "_" var "${var}")
+
+ cmake_parse_arguments(PARAMS "" "NAME" "INCLUDE_FILES" ${ARGN})
+
+ if(PARAMS_NAME)
+ set(var ${PARAMS_NAME})
+ endif()
+
+ set(CMAKE_EXTRA_INCLUDE_FILES "${PARAMS_INCLUDE_FILES}")
+
+ CHECK_INCLUDE_FILE(${header} ${var})
+
+ if(${${var}})
+ SET_GLOBAL(HEADER_FILE_CONTENT "${HEADER_FILE_CONTENT}#define ${var} 1\n")
+ else()
+ SET_GLOBAL(HEADER_FILE_CONTENT "${HEADER_FILE_CONTENT}#undef ${var}\n")
+ endif()
+endfunction()
+
+# FUNC_CHECK(func [NAME variable]
+# [INCLUDE_FILES header1.h .. headerN.h]
+# [LIBRARIES lib1 ... libN]
+# [DEFINITIONS -DA=1 .. -DN=123]
+# [FLAGS -cmdlineparam1 .. -cmdlineparamN]
+# [CXX])
+#
+# Check if the function exists, in such case define variable in
+# configuration file.
+#
+# Variable defaults to HAVE_${FUNC}, where FUNC is the uppercase
+# representation of the first parameter. It can be overridden using
+# NAME keyword.
+#
+# To define include files use INCLUDE_FILES keyword.
+#
+# To use C++ compiler, use CXX keyword
+function(FUNC_CHECK func)
+ string(TOUPPER HAVE_${func} var)
+ string(REGEX REPLACE "_{2,}" "_" var "${var}")
+
+ cmake_parse_arguments(PARAMS "CXX" "NAME" "INCLUDE_FILES;LIBRARIES;DEFINITIONS;FLAGS" ${ARGN})
+
+ set(CMAKE_REQUIRED_LIBRARIES "${PARAMS_LIBRARIES}")
+ set(CMAKE_REQUIRED_DEFINITIONS "${PARAMS_DEFINITIONS}")
+ set(CMAKE_REQUIRED_FLAGS "${PARAMS_FLAGS}")
+
+ if(PARAMS_CXX)
+ check_cxx_symbol_exists(${func} "${PARAMS_INCLUDE_FILES}" ${var})
+ else()
+ check_symbol_exists(${func} "${PARAMS_INCLUDE_FILES}" ${var})
+ endif()
+
+ if(${${var}} )
+ SET_GLOBAL(HEADER_FILE_CONTENT "${HEADER_FILE_CONTENT}#define ${var} 1\n")
+ else()
+ SET_GLOBAL(HEADER_FILE_CONTENT "${HEADER_FILE_CONTENT}#undef ${var}\n")
+ endif()
+endfunction()
+
+# TYPE_CHECK(type [NAME variable]
+# [INCLUDE_FILES file1.h ... fileN.h]
+# [LIBRARIES lib1 ... libN]
+# [DEFINITIONS -DA=1 .. -DN=123]
+# [FLAGS -cmdlineparam1 .. -cmdlineparamN]
+# [CXX])
+#
+# Check if the type exists and its size, in such case define variable
+# in configuration file.
+#
+# Variable defaults to HAVE_${TYPE}, where TYPE is the uppercase
+# representation of the first parameter. It can be overridden using
+# NAME keyword.
+#
+# To define include files use INCLUDE_FILES keyword.
+#
+# To use C++ compiler, use CXX keyword
+function(TYPE_CHECK type)
+ string(TOUPPER HAVE_${type} var)
+ string(REGEX REPLACE "_{2,}" "_" var "${var}")
+
+ cmake_parse_arguments(PARAMS "CXX" "NAME" "INCLUDE_FILES;LIBRARIES;DEFINITIONS;FLAGS" ${ARGN})
+
+ set(CMAKE_REQUIRED_LIBRARIES "${PARAMS_LIBRARIES}")
+ set(CMAKE_REQUIRED_DEFINITIONS "${PARAMS_DEFINITIONS}")
+ set(CMAKE_REQUIRED_FLAGS "${PARAMS_FLAGS}")
+ set(CMAKE_EXTRA_INCLUDE_FILES "${PARAMS_INCLUDE_FILES}")
+
+ if(PARAMS_CXX)
+ set(lang CXX)
+ else()
+ set(lang C)
+ endif()
+
+ CHECK_TYPE_SIZE(${type} ${var} LANGUAGE ${lang})
+
+ if(HAVE_${var})
+ SET_GLOBAL(HEADER_FILE_CONTENT "${HEADER_FILE_CONTENT}#define ${var} 1\n")
+ else()
+ SET_GLOBAL(HEADER_FILE_CONTENT "${HEADER_FILE_CONTENT}#undef ${var}\n")
+ endif()
+endfunction()
+
+# EFL_HEADER_CHECKS_FINALIZE(file)
+#
+# Write the configuration gathered with HEADER_CHECK(), TYPE_CHECK()
+# and FUNC_CHECK() to the given file.
+function(EFL_HEADER_CHECKS_FINALIZE file)
+ file(WRITE ${file}.new ${HEADER_FILE_CONTENT})
+ if (NOT EXISTS ${file})
+ file(RENAME ${file}.new ${file})
+ message(STATUS "${file} was generated.")
+ else()
+ file(MD5 ${file}.new _new_md5)
+ file(MD5 ${file} _old_md5)
+ if(_new_md5 STREQUAL _old_md5)
+ message(STATUS "${file} is unchanged.")
+ else()
+ file(REMOVE ${file})
+ file(RENAME ${file}.new ${file})
+ message(STATUS "${file} was updated.")
+ endif()
+ endif()
+ unset(HEADER_FILE_CONTENT CACHE) # allow to reuse with an empty contents
+endfunction()
